Challenge
AI-generated work cannot be copyrighted, and when human creativity mixes with AI output, ownership becomes murky with no clear formula and courts still deciding where the line is. Businesses and entire creative industries are exposing themselves to that uncertainty without realizing it. The challenge was to take dense, unresolved legal territory and make it readable, fast, and impossible to dismiss, without lecturing or finger-pointing.
Approach
The piece is structured as a tension-building editorial series, 14 screens that move from legal exposure to resolution. A WWII poster aesthetic was chosen deliberately. It evokes handmade human artistry, signals urgency without alarm, and anchors the work in a visual tradition associated with collective action and civic responsibility. The framing throughout is empowering rather than accusatory: if this is the outcome you want, here is how you get there.
Outcome
The style frames phase is complete, with motion design in After Effects as the next step. Once completed, it will be released across social media as a primer, prompting businesses and creatives to think critically about whether AI-generated content is a wise long-term strategy or simply a short-term convenience.
